Beef jerky is high ... WebMar 31, 2016 · View Full Report Card. Fawn Creek Township is located in Kansas with a … WebPierce the skin with a knife or by blanching and shocking. Place on the dehydrator trays and dry at 135° for 18 to 48 hours, or until dry and tacky. Cool to room temperature. Place the dried grapes in a jar with extra space. Store for 7 days, shaking the jar every day. If any moisture appears, dehydrate the grapes further. title eight of the civil rights act of 1968

WebJust as prunes are dehydrated plums, raisins are dried grapes. Of the more than 8,000 cultivated grape varieties, only some are well-suited for raisin production. Most raisins made in the United States come from Thompson Seedless, Flame Seedless, Muscat, Black Corinth and Sultana grapes. Drying Thompson grapes in the sun for about three weeks ...
